Fungal peritonitis is a rare but serious complication of peritoneal dialysis. The aim of this study was to analyze peritonitis rates, associated factors, clinical course, microbiological aspects, therapeutic regimens, and outcome of patients with fungal peritonitis in the dialysis center of a teaching hospital over the last 25 years. This report describes novel fungal inocula for bioaugmentation of soils contaminated with hazardous organic compounds. The inocula are in the form of pelleted solid substrates coated with a sodium alginate suspension of fungal spores or mycelial fragments and incubated until overgrown with the mycelium of selected lignin-degrading fungi. Bipolaris zeicola is a fungal pathogen that causes Northern corn leaf spot (NCLS), which is a serious foliar disease in maize and one of the most significant pathogens affecting global food security. Here, we report a genome-wide transcriptional profile analysis using next-generation sequencing (NGS) of maize leaf development after inoculation with B. zeicola. Invasive fungal rhinosinusitis is a potentially fatal infection that affects immunocompromised patients. Prognosis is generally poor despite aggressive medical and surgical treatments. We present the first reported case of invasive fungal sinusitis in a healthy 18-year-old male athlete who was taking anabolic androgenic steroids (AAS). The biotrophic basidiomycete fungus Ustilago maydis causes smut disease in maize. Hallmarks of the disease are large tumors that develop on all aerial parts of the host in which dark pigmented teliospores are formed. In the fungal pathogen Cryptococcus neoformans, the switch from yeast to hypha is an important morphological process preceding the meiotic events during sexual development. Morphotype is also known to be associated with cryptococcal virulence potential.
